Embodiment 1
[0025] like figure 1 As shown, a double-head manual spray gun test method includes the following steps:
[0026] a. Spray gun service life test: automatic test machine 5000 times cycle test;
[0027] b. Pressure test of spray gun body: Inject gas with a pressure of 8KG into the gun body for 60 minutes;
[0028] c. Sealing test: Connect the air pipe joint, the gas pressure is 3KG, and the gun body is immersed in water. When the oil adjustment screw 4 and the air seal screw 5 are immersed in water, the number of bubbles emerging from their positions is less than 20 per minute, which is qualified. ;When the inner nozzle insert 1, the gun holder handle 2, and the oil seal screw 6 are immersed in water, there should be no air bubbles in their positions within 1 minute; check the air tightness of the gas adjustment screw 7: connect the gas, the gas pressure is 3KG, and the dot Switch between spraying and fan-shaped spraying.
